    Hi everyone!

    I have a question about the shoulder boards below:

    Color piping on shoulder boards - Waffenfarbe

    I read that's a recon shoulder board. But the brown was only used for recon in the Heer, am I right?

    So can it be concentration guards shoulder boards?

    I found many different documents showing "waffenfarbe" but they have many differences between them and a lot of mistakes...

    Thank you for your answers!

    As far as I'm aware, the Waffen SS used the same colors as the Heer, so this is indeed either Recon or KZ Personnel...I can't tell if yours is Kupferbraun/Copperbrown or Hellbraun/Light Brown...I look forward to the opinions of our knowledgeable SS Collectors...

    Cloth Insignia of the SS states , Copper brown - reconnaissance , Light brown - KL
